Mazda 2: DTC Inspection [Audio]
NOTE:
- All DTCs displayed in the on-board diagnostic test mode should be
entered in the Audio
Repair Order Form.
1. Turn the ignition switch to the ACC or ON position.
2. Turn the center panel unit power to off.
3. While pressing the POWER/VOLUME switch, simultaneously press the SCAN switch
and the
Preset switch 2 switch for 3 s or more.
![Mazda 2. DTC INSPECTION [AUDIO]](images/books/1059/mazda_2_dtc_inspection_audio__2899.gif)
NOTE:
- If several DTCs are in the memory, they can be displayed using the UP
SEEK switch or DOWN SEEK switch.
4. To stop the on-board diagnostic test mode, turn the ignition switch to the
LOCK position.
SUPPLIER IDENTIFICATION PROCEDURE [Audio]
NOTE:
- When asking the supplier (service center) for repair or replacement,
identify the
supplier and fill in the Audio Repair Order Form using the following
procedures.
Identification Using Label or Inscribed Lettering
1.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
2. Remove the following parts:
- Front scuff plate (See FRONT SCUFF PLATE REMOVAL/INSTALLATION).
- Front side trim (See FRONT SIDE TRIM REMOVAL/INSTALLATION).
- Console panel (See REAR CONSOLE REMOVAL/INSTALLATION).
- Rear console (See REAR CONSOLE REMOVAL/INSTALLATION).
- Side wall (See SIDE WALL REMOVAL/INSTALLATION).
- Shift lever knob (MTX) (See MANUAL TRANSAXLE SHIFT MECHANISM
REMOVAL/INSTALLATION).
- Front console component (See FRONT CONSOLE COMPONENT
REMOVAL/INSTALLATION).
- Glove compartment (See GLOVE COMPARTMENT REMOVAL/INSTALLATION).
- Lower panel (See LOWER PANEL REMOVAL/INSTALLATION).
- Center panel unit (See CENTER PANEL UNIT REMOVAL/INSTALLATION).
3. Verify the supplier indicated on the label attached on each unit.

Verify Using the Diagnostic Assist Function
1. Switch the ignition to ACC or ON.
2. Turn the audio unit power to on.
3. While pressing the POWER/VOLUME switch, simultaneously press the Preset 5
switch for 3
s or more.
![Mazda 2. SUPPLIER IDENTIFICATION PROCEDURE [AUDIO]](images/books/1059/mazda_2_dtc_inspection_audio__2901.gif)
4. Identify the supplier code by referring to the LCD.

NOTE:
- The supplier code can also be identified from the DTC displays screen.
5. To stop the diagnostic assist function, ignition is switched to off or
turning off the audio
unit power.
CLEARING DTC [Audio]
CAUTION:
- Before clearing the memory, be sure to enter all of the DTCs displayed
in the DTC
inspection in the Audio Repair Order Form.
1. Launch the DTC inspection. (See DTC INSPECTION [AUDIO] ).
2. While pressing the POWER/VOLUME switch, simultaneously press the MENU switch
for 3 s
or more.
![Mazda 2. CLEARING DTC [AUDIO]](images/books/1059/mazda_2_dtc_inspection_audio__2906.gif)
3. To stop the DTC inspection, ignition is switched to off.
